Winding equipment for preparing raw material belt
Technical Field
The utility model relates to a winding equipment field in raw material area, in particular to winding equipment for preparing raw material area.
Background
The raw material belt is an auxiliary article commonly used in liquid pipeline installation, is used for a pipe fitting joint, enhances the leakproofness of the pipe fitting joint, and is usually wound and rolled in the preparation process.
The reel that will twine the raw material area alternates to be established on the installation pole usually, drives the reel through the installation pole and rotates, twines and the rolling to the raw material area, and the reel in raw material area is not convenient for install and fixes on the installation pole, is not convenient for take off the coiled material after the completion of the coil, reduces the efficiency of production.

Detailed Description
The technical solutions in the embodiments of the present invention will be described clearly and completely with reference to the accompanying drawings in the embodiments of the present invention, and it is obvious that the described embodiments are only some embodiments of the present invention, not all embodiments. Based on the embodiments in the present invention, all other embodiments obtained by a person skilled in the art without creative work belong to the protection scope of the present invention.
The utility model provides a winding device for preparing raw material belt as shown in figures 1-3, which comprises a mounting frame 1, wherein the mounting frame 1 is used for mounting and supporting a mounting rod 2, one side of the mounting frame 1 is provided with the mounting rod 2 for mounting a winding drum for winding the raw material belt, and the winding drum is arranged on the mounting rod 2 in an alternating manner, so that the mounting rod 2 drives the winding drum to rotate to wind the raw material belt;
one end of the connecting shaft 3 is fixedly connected with the middle part of one end of the mounting rod 2, the connecting shaft 3 is used for connecting the mounting rod 2 and an output shaft of the motor 4, the output end of the motor 4 is in transmission connection with the other end of the connecting shaft 3, the motor 4 is electrically connected with an external power supply through an external switch, and the connecting shaft 3 and the mounting rod 2 are driven to rotate through the operation of the motor 4, so that the green tape is conveniently wound;
the mounting rod 2 is provided with a fixing mechanism 5 for fixing the winding drum, and the fixing mechanism 5 is used for stably fixing the winding drum on the mounting rod 2 so as to ensure the winding drum to stably rotate along with the mounting rod 2 and ensure the stability of the winding drum;
the fixing mechanism 5 comprises two extrusion blocks 51, the extrusion blocks 51 are arranged in a long strip shape, the winding drum is sleeved on the installation rod 2, so that the two extrusion blocks 51 are arranged in an inner cavity of the winding drum and used for extruding the inner wall of the winding drum, the top and the bottom of the installation rod 2 are both provided with movable grooves 52, the movable grooves 52 are used for installing the extrusion blocks 51 and accommodating the extrusion blocks 51 in the inner cavity of the movable grooves 52, the inner cavity of the movable grooves 52 is connected with the extrusion blocks 51 in a sliding and penetrating manner, the bottom of the inner wall of the movable grooves 52 is provided with through grooves 53 which are in a penetrating manner and used for installing the movable blocks 54, the inner cavity of the through grooves 53 is internally provided with movable blocks 54, the movable blocks 54 horizontally move in the inner cavity of the through grooves 53, the top and the bottom of the movable blocks 54 are both arranged in an inclined plane, the middle part of the movable blocks 54 is connected with a screw rod 55 in a threaded manner in a penetrating manner, the movable blocks 54 move in the horizontal direction through the rotation of the screw rod 55, the extrusion blocks 51 are provided with sliding grooves 56, the two sliding grooves 56 which are respectively arranged at the top and the bottom of the two extrusion blocks 51, the inner wall of the movable blocks 51, and the inner wall of the movable blocks 56 is attached to the inner cavity of the movable blocks, and the extrusion blocks 51, and the inner wall of the movable blocks 51, and the movable blocks 56, and the movable blocks is attached to the extrusion blocks 51 in the inclined plane, and the extrusion blocks 51;
one end of the screw 55 is rotatably connected with one end of the inner wall of the through groove 53, the other end of the screw 55 is rotatably inserted and connected with the other end of the mounting rod 2, the inner wall of the chute 56 is attached to the inner wall of the chute 56, and the screw 55 is rotated in the inner cavity of the through groove 53 by rotating one end of the screw 55 to drive the movable block 54 to move;
two clamping grooves 6 are formed in two sides of the inner wall of the movable groove 52, the clamping grooves 6 are used for mounting fixed rods 7, two fixed rods 7 are fixedly connected to two sides of the extrusion block 51, one end of each fixed rod 7 is slidably and alternately connected with the inner cavity of the clamping groove 6, the extrusion block 51 is connected with the clamping grooves 6 through the fixed rods 7, and when the extrusion block 51 moves in the vertical direction, the fixed rods 7 are driven to slide in the inner cavity of the clamping grooves 6, so that stable movement of the extrusion block 51 is guaranteed, and the extrusion block 51 is prevented from being separated from the movable groove 52;
the top of the mounting frame 1 is fixedly provided with a bearing 8, one end of the connecting shaft 3 is rotatably and alternately connected with the top of the mounting frame 1 through the bearing 8, and the bearing 8 is used for connecting the connecting shaft 3 with the mounting frame 1, supporting the connecting shaft 3 and the mounting rod 2 and ensuring the stable rotation of the mounting rod 2;
other fixedly connected with rubber pad 9 is equallyd divide to the upper surface and the lower surface of two extrusion pieces 51, extrusion piece 51 passes through the inner wall contact of rubber pad 9 with the reel, when extrusion piece 51 extrudees the inner wall of reel, make rubber pad 9 take place deformation, utilize the rubber pad 9 to increase the frictional force with the reel inner wall, it is fixed to carry out stable extrusion to the reel, the outer wall of movable block 54 and the inner wall that leads to groove 53 laminate mutually, the back fixedly connected with fixed block 10 of mounting bracket 1, the upper surface of fixed block 10 and the lower fixed surface installation of motor 4.
The utility model discloses the theory of operation: the winding drum with the wound raw material belt is sleeved on the installation rod 2, two extrusion blocks 51 are arranged in an inner cavity of the winding drum, the rotation of the screw 55 is rotated, the movable block 54 moves in the horizontal direction along the screw 55, the inclined plane of the movable block 54 extrudes the inclined plane of the sliding groove 56, the extrusion blocks 51 move in the vertical direction, the extrusion blocks 51 slide out of the inner cavity of the movable groove 52, the inner wall of the winding drum is extruded, the winding drum is fixed on the installation rod 2, meanwhile, when the extrusion blocks 51 move in the vertical direction, the extrusion blocks 51 slide in the inner cavity of the movable groove 52, the fixing rods 7 are driven to slide in the inner cavity of the clamping grooves 6, the movement of the extrusion blocks 51 is limited, the stable movement of the extrusion blocks 51 is guaranteed, and the extrusion blocks 51 are prevented from being separated from the movable groove 52.
